"Jim Cone" wrote:


I haven't used the BreakLink method.
However, reviewing BreakLink in the help file reveals that "Name" should
refer to the name of the link. Also, the LinkSources method for a workbook
returns an array of all of the link names in the workbook...

Background...Win XP...Xcel 2002....WB1 stores data on WS "DATA",
reports and charts are generated on quarterly WS's then saved off to
new individual WB's...
the link should be broken to the original WB but this is where the
program halts with this msg..
"Run-time error '1004'
Method 'Breaklink' of Object'_Workbook' Failed"
The code below....
'-snip-
' and next is where I want to break the link to the original WB1

ActiveWorkbook.BreakLink Name:= "C:\************\LEADS _
PROGRAM 2007-2008.xls", Type:= xlExcelLinks
